







|
| C# Webserver |
| HttpClientContext Constructor (Boolean, RequestReceivedHandler, ClientDisconnectedHandler, Stream, WriteLogHandler) |
| HttpClientContext Class See Also Send Feedback |
Initializes a new instance of the HttpClientContext class.
Namespace:
HttpServer
Assembly:
HttpServer (in HttpServer.dll) Version: 1.0.0.0 (1.0.0.0)
Syntax
| C# |
|---|
public HttpClientContext( bool secured, RequestReceivedHandler requestHandler, ClientDisconnectedHandler disconnectHandler, Stream stream, WriteLogHandler writer ) |
| Visual Basic (Declaration) |
|---|
Public Sub New ( _ secured As Boolean, _ requestHandler As RequestReceivedHandler, _ disconnectHandler As ClientDisconnectedHandler, _ stream As Stream, _ writer As WriteLogHandler _ ) |
| Visual C++ |
|---|
public: HttpClientContext( bool secured, RequestReceivedHandler^ requestHandler, ClientDisconnectedHandler^ disconnectHandler, Stream^ stream, WriteLogHandler^ writer ) |
Parameters
- secured
- Type: System..::.Boolean
true if the connection is secured (SSL/TLS)
- requestHandler
- Type: HttpServer..::.RequestReceivedHandler
delegate handling incoming requests.
- disconnectHandler
- Type: HttpServer..::.ClientDisconnectedHandler
delegate being called when a client disconnectes
- stream
- Type: System.IO..::.Stream
Stream used for communication
- writer
- Type: HttpServer..::.WriteLogHandler
delegate used to write log entries
Exceptions
| Exception | Condition |
|---|---|
| System.Net.Sockets..::.SocketException | If beginreceive fails |
